🔧

wrench

Unicode: 1F527

Description

A spanner, a tool used for turning nuts and bolts. Often depicted as a silver or grey wrench with a handle and a curved head.

Backstory

This emoji was introduced in Unicode 6.0 in 2010. It is a standard representation of a hand tool used for tightening or loosening fasteners.
